Charmed


46 Haywood Street #6
Asheville, NC 28801

 

A Boutique in Asheville NC

Charmed is a charming fashion jewelry and accessory boutique located in the heart of downtown Asheville, NC on Haywood Street.


Day Opening Closing
Mon-Thu 10:00am 7:00pm
Fri-Sun 10:00am 8:00pm
Click the button to add a review for Charmed

Add Review